In triangle XYZ right angled at Y. Find the length of the hypotenuse if the length of the other two sides is 1.6 cm and 6.3 cm.
const2013 [10]

Answer:

6.5 cm

Step-by-step explanation:

From Pythagoras theorem

C^2= a^2 + b^2

Where a, b are the sides of the triangle

C= hypotenus sides of the triangle

two sides are given as 1.6 cm and 6.3cm respectively.

C^2= 1.6^2 + 6.3^2

C^2= 2.56 + 39.69

C^2 = 42.25

C= √42.25

C=6.5 cm

Hence, the length of the hypotenuse is 6.5 cm
